Output 86e2c10336ee7f7f2c18b158dd1eef8eb5af3999316f1ca2ed18cfcc72e60a45:16

value
1629708
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f564da2848578bf0117cd908b8d2aa1dd20e4e6 OP_EQUALVERIFY OP_CHECKSIG
address
18EVmcQ5JQbR1pfPB5GKyvDqqHgt3izeH1
transaction
86e2c10336ee7f7f2c18b158dd1eef8eb5af3999316f1ca2ed18cfcc72e60a45
spent
true